Western Cape death toll increases to 18 660

Published on

The Western Cape’s Covid-19 death toll has risen to 18 660.

This is an increase of 58 deaths since Friday afternoon.

Over the past 24 hours, 1 764 new cases of covid-19 have been reported here.

The province currently has 27 681 active cases of the virus.
